在数字化时代,数据传输的安全性、速度和兼容性是企业和个人用户关注的焦点。FTP(File Transfer Protocol,文件传输协议)作为一种广泛使用的文件传输工具,以其安全性和高效性赢得了众多用户的青睐。然而,在使用FTP进行数据传输时,我们也需要关注隐私保护和兼容性问题。
FTP数据传输的基本原理
FTP是一种基于TCP/IP协议的应用层协议,主要用于在网络上进行文件传输。它允许用户在客户端和服务器之间上传和下载文件。FTP协议的工作原理如下:
- 建立连接:客户端通过FTP客户端软件连接到FTP服务器,建立TCP连接。
- 用户认证:客户端需要提供用户名和密码进行身份验证。
- 文件传输:客户端可以上传文件到服务器,或从服务器下载文件。
- 关闭连接:传输完成后,客户端关闭与服务器的连接。
FTP数据传输的优势
- 安全性:FTP支持多种安全协议,如SSL和TLS,可以确保数据在传输过程中的安全性。
- 速度:FTP协议优化了文件传输过程,可以快速传输大量数据。
- 兼容性:FTP协议广泛应用于各种操作系统和设备,具有较好的兼容性。
隐私保护问题
尽管FTP协议本身具有安全性,但在实际应用中,仍存在以下隐私保护问题:
- 明文传输:默认情况下,FTP使用的是明文传输,容易受到中间人攻击。
- 密码泄露:用户名和密码在传输过程中可能被截获,导致账户信息泄露。
兼容性问题
- 不同版本:FTP协议存在多个版本,不同版本之间可能存在兼容性问题。
- 操作系统:不同操作系统对FTP协议的支持程度不同,可能导致兼容性问题。
解决方案
- 使用安全协议:建议使用SSL或TLS等安全协议,确保数据传输过程中的安全性。
- 加密密码:使用加密技术对用户名和密码进行加密,防止泄露。
- 选择合适的FTP服务器:选择兼容性好的FTP服务器,确保不同版本和操作系统之间的兼容性。
总结
FTP数据传输具有安全、快速和兼容性等优点,但在实际应用中,我们需要关注隐私保护和兼容性问题。通过采取相应的措施,我们可以更好地利用FTP进行数据传输,确保数据的安全性和可靠性。